NXPI Likely to Beat Q4 Earnings Estimates: How to Play the Stock
ZACKS· 2026-01-29 15:36
Core Insights - NXP Semiconductors (NXPI) is set to report its fourth-quarter 2025 results on February 2, with expected revenues between $3.2 billion and $3.4 billion, reflecting a year-over-year increase of 6.2% [1] - The anticipated non-GAAP earnings per share (EPS) for the fourth quarter is projected to be between $3.07 and $3.49, with a consensus estimate of $3.30 per share, indicating a 3.8% year-over-year increase [2] Revenue Expectations - Automotive revenues are expected to grow in the mid-single digits year-over-year, with a Zacks Consensus Estimate of $1.88 billion, representing a 5.3% increase from the previous year [3] - Industrial and Internet of Things (IoT) revenues are projected to rise in the mid-20% range year-over-year, with a consensus estimate of $637.6 million, indicating a 25.5% increase [4] - Mobile end market revenues are anticipated to increase in the mid-teens percent range year-over-year, with a consensus estimate of $452.1 million, reflecting a 14.2% increase [5] - Communication Infrastructure & Other end markets are expected to see a revenue decline of around 20% year-over-year, with a consensus estimate of $327 million [6] Earnings Prediction - The company's earnings model suggests a strong likelihood of an earnings beat, supported by a positive Earnings ESP of +0.19% and a Zacks Rank of 2 (Buy) [7]

辰致科技:iPCS项目域控平台获突破 智能网联汽车核心计算技术跻身国内领先
Core Insights - ChenZhi Technology has made significant breakthroughs in the development of a domain control general open computing platform through the iPCS project, positioning itself among the leading companies in the core computing field of intelligent connected vehicles [1][4] - The automotive industry's electronic and electrical architecture is rapidly evolving towards a "central computing + regional control" model, moving away from traditional distributed software architectures [1] Industry Challenges - The development model of "big chips + big software" has led to high communication costs, low integration efficiency, significant system debugging challenges, weak software IP protection, and insufficient business isolation, which are key obstacles to the large-scale implementation of domain controllers and the progress of "software-defined vehicles" [1] Technological Solutions - ChenZhi Technology has developed an integrated solution for the domain control general open computing platform, focusing on "virtualization" and "multi-level hardware isolation" as core technological pillars, enabling secure isolation of multiple business operations on a single hardware platform [3] - The solution supports independent development of functional modules, cross-entity secure integration, dynamic and flexible deployment of computing power, and lightweight firmware upgrades, facilitating efficient resource integration for OEMs [3] Collaborative Efforts - To strengthen the technical foundation of the project, ChenZhi Technology has formed a joint project team with the Innovation Research Institute, leveraging each party's technical expertise to overcome core technological challenges such as virtualization interrupt handling and virtual machine scheduling mechanisms [3] - The project team has also engaged in deep strategic collaborations with leading international companies like ETAS and NXP, enhancing the industrial adaptability of the solution with complete vehicle software platform solutions based on AUTOSAR standards [3] Innovation Highlights - During the project, over ten key technological topics were developed, with a notable highlight being the application of a self-developed time analysis tool that enables precise visualization of virtual machine scheduling and task scheduling timing [4] - The successful development of the domain control general open computing platform signifies a critical technological breakthrough for ChenZhi Technology in the "central computing + regional control" architecture, injecting new momentum into the technological upgrade of the intelligent connected vehicle industry [4] Future Directions - Looking ahead, ChenZhi Technology aims to continue promoting the open and standardized construction of the platform, with the goal of building a software ecosystem that spans across chips and vehicle models, thereby accelerating the pace of technological innovation for OEMs [4]
